Output 5869b81fe57ccd9e815b344b813335104c531fd9fbf9d34fe10d0ef2c7e47d1e:5

value
5300150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6a1835944144a9bee742b5292a9f0099875824 OP_EQUAL
address
3QcNdGnYPQaYPs8iCodfsy3WvCrG9GxVy9
transaction
5869b81fe57ccd9e815b344b813335104c531fd9fbf9d34fe10d0ef2c7e47d1e
spent
true